Dallas is taking significant steps to enhance support for veterans, particularly those experiencing homelessness, as discussed in the recent Veteran Affairs Commission meeting on June 13, 2025. A key focus of the meeting was the implementation of advanced data analysis techniques to better understand and address the needs of veterans in the community.

Commission members emphasized the importance of utilizing algorithms and machine learning to sift through various reports and identify interactions involving veterans. This data-driven approach aims to pinpoint specific locations where veterans may be in need, thereby allowing for targeted interventions and support services. The integration of Geographic Information System (GIS) data will further enhance the ability to visualize and analyze these interactions, providing a clearer picture of where resources are most needed.

In response to inquiries about the participation of homeless veterans in upcoming forums, officials confirmed ongoing efforts to engage this vulnerable population. Collaborations with local organizations, including the veterans treatment court, are underway to ensure that veterans who have experienced homelessness can share their perspectives in a supportive environment. The commission is prioritizing the inclusion of veterans who are in recovery and stable enough to contribute meaningfully to discussions.

The meeting also highlighted the necessity of identifying veterans within the homeless population, particularly those lacking identification. Strategies discussed included leveraging information from police, fire, and emergency medical services reports to confirm veteran status during interactions. This approach aims to ensure that veterans receive the appropriate services and support they need.

Overall, the commission's commitment to data-driven solutions and community collaboration signals a proactive approach to addressing the challenges faced by veterans in Dallas. As these initiatives unfold, they are expected to lead to improved services and outcomes for veterans, particularly those experiencing homelessness. The commission plans to continue refining its strategies and gathering data to enhance its understanding of veterans' needs in the city.
